How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Baldwin?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Baldwin Studio Apartments | $900 | $900 | $900 |
Baldwin 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,690 | $900 | $2,763 |
| Baldwin 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,851 | $950 | $2,970 |
| Baldwin 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,863 | $2,266 | $4,440 |
| Baldwin 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,162 | $4,050 | $4,375 |
